    Barneys 2nd Markdown

    Barneys started their second markdown today online and in stores. Most sale merchandise is now 60% off. There is still a wide assortment of fall/winter shoes, bags and ready-to-wear. Another markdown may come but most of the stuff you want will be gone by then.

    The Barneys markdown is great because it includes an impressive assortment of shoes and bags too. A Mark Cross bag is $1200 from $3000 and a Givenchy Obsedia is $1200 from $3000. Among the shoes there is Prada riding boots $600 from $1500, Saint Laurent creepers are $439 from $1100 and suede Manolo BBs are $240 from $600.

    Among the clothing we found a red draped Lanvin dress for $879 from $2200, a Givenchy sweater is $619 from $1550, a Carven sweatshirt is $159 from $400 and a Thakoon Addiction hooded cape is $399 from $990.

    There should be one more markdown before the season comes to a close but there are usually not many desirable options. Shop now for the prime assortment, shop later for the irresistible prices.

    Roger Vivier Sale

    Roger Vivier’s seasonal sale is usually a well kept secret that’s only accessible to customers who have previously shopped at the boutique and paid full price. This year, however, most anyone can take advantage of the Vivier sale.

    A large assortment of classic and updated Viviers are 30% to 40% off. The sale started on Black Friday but there is still a large selection of styles and sizes available. Basic flats come to about $450 from $600 and boots that normally retail for $1100 and are reduced to $660.

    You can buy shoes on-line via their e-commerce website but the discount is only available in the boutique. You can see pictures from our sale hunt right this way.

    Saks Begins Second Markdown

    It’s beginning to feel a lot like Christmas. Everywhere we go there are sales but we are still waiting for more. Today, Saks Fifth Avenue granted our wish and kicked off their second markdown, which brings yesterday’s discount of 40%– down to 60% off.

    The remaining small assortment of bags and shoes are still just 30% off. If you want to shop the good discounts you’re going to have to sort through the clothing options. A Stella McCartney abstract zipper sweatshirt is nearly affordable at $385 from $1070, an asymmetrical Marni peplum blouse is $259 from $723, a 3.1 Phillip Lim ‘Cash Only’ sweatshirt is $135 from $375. If you look carefully you can still find some of this season’s most iconic pieces, like the Stella McCartney squiggly face coat and the embellished Marni midi-skirt.

    The sale is just online for now, but we bet that a store manager can easily make adjustments. The markdown becomes official in stores on Friday.

    Proenza Schouler 50% Off (Incl. Bags)

    Proenza Schouler is offering holiday shoppers a 50% savings. The discount extends to shoes and bags, which makes this the ideal place to shop for the designer’s popular PS1 and PS11 bags. The discount is also available online here.

    In the boutique we found mini-PS1s in green, purple, blue, orange and yellow along with a few print and exotic skins. They are all about $650 from $1325. The exotic style is more, of course. The sale assortment of the large size comes in red, blue, green, snake and print. Those are mostly $1300 from $2600. Large PS11s come in white, belle, patent black, kelly green, embossed and brown suede and are also 50% off. You can click here to see all the sale bags available at the Madison Avenue boutique.

    The sale also includes a great assortment of shoes and clothing, like these high heel booties for $525 from $1050 and tall boots are a relative deal for $648 from $1295. Check out this iconic peplum print dress that’s $1225 from $2450 or a print tee is $140 from $280.
